Is there a right and wrong way to perform a home inspection? In this episode, we dive deep into one of the most debated topics in the home inspection industry — whether there are absolute truths when it comes to inspection standards, reporting methods, and professional judgment. And there's nobody better than Joey McPeek of Peek Home Inspections to speak on the topic. Well known and well respected in the Boise real estate market, Joey's build a reputation for shooting straight... and also pushing back on conventional home inspection norms. We discuss: ✔ Are there objective "right" and "wrong" ways to inspect a home? ✔ How much interpretation is involved in a home inspection report? ✔ Standards of Practice vs. personal inspection style ✔ Risk management and liability considerations ✔ Should the home buyer be present during the inspection? ✔ Pros and cons of buyer attendance at inspections From buyer presence at inspections to gray areas in defect evaluation, this episode explores how inspectors balance professionalism, liability, ethics, and client education.
